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is also a moderately hot month in Tadó, Colombia, with an average temperature fluctuating between 29.3°C (84.7°F) and 21.7°C (71.1°F).

Temperature

August's arrival presents an average high temperature of a still warm 29.3°C (84.7°F), indicating consistency with July's weather. During August, Tadó records a consistent average nighttime temperature of 21.7°C (71.1°F).

Heat index

In August, the heat index is calculated to be a sweltering 38°C (100.4°F). Exercise heightened safety,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are probable. Persistent activity may provoke heatstroke.
Heat index's context suggests values are appropriate for shady areas and slight breezes. With exposure to direct sunlight, the heat index may be increased by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in August in Tadó is 88%.

Rainfall

August is the month with the most rainfall. Rain falls for 30.3 days and accumulates 422mm (16.61") of precipitation.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 12h and 17min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:02 and sunset at 18:22. On the last day of August, in Tadó, sunrise is at 05:59 and sunset at 18:12 -05.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August is 7.4h.
